To create the croutons I created a box with lots of segments for height, width and depth, I then converted it to an editable poly,
I then used the move tool and the vertices selection to click and drag points of the box in to make it look indented and misshaped like a real crouton,
Once I was happy with the shape I added ‘turbosmooth’ and ‘meshsmooth’ modifiers to it to make it look smoother
I then wanted to add a material to the crouton to make it look legitimate, so I looked for a image of toast to add as the bump map and diffuse colour, this is the toast map I used - http://endingb.com/images/toast.png, here is a shot of the finished crouton.
At the end of the scene for this ident I want the camera to come above the soup and have a birds eye view above it looking down on the croutons spelling out the word ‘UKTV Food’ so I had to create the shape of the letters using the croutons, to do this I cloned the croutons and moved them into shape.
